Output e577d2b462a1db4c663bc9ce60c980e7fec24718f2615e91c7c507af90aabf33:2

value
52911382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f6cd170369fa8d4af7ede32cca37c50ab4f999d OP_EQUAL
address
MJ4KbYCjXJYfisj8HsU6exKbjWo575HtBp
transaction
e577d2b462a1db4c663bc9ce60c980e7fec24718f2615e91c7c507af90aabf33
spent
true